成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

使用SVN建立本地文件管理方法詳解

開發 項目管理
在學習SVN的過程中,你可能會遇到SVN建立本地文件方面的知識,這里向大家介紹一下如何正確使用SVN建立本地文件管理,歡迎大家一起來學習。

本節和大家一起學習一下正確使用SVN建立本地文件管理的方法,這是在學習SVN時可能會遇到的問題,所以拿來和大家分享一下,希望通過本文的介紹大家對正確使用SVN建立本地文件管理有深刻的理解。
如何正確使用SVN建立本地文件管理

SVN是一款功能強大的版本控制系統,對于習慣于windows環境的中國工程師而言,使用TortoiseSVN是個不錯的選擇,其友好的界面和易用的操作使得其很容易掌握。

從網址:http://tortoisesvn.net/downloads可以下載到最新版的TortoiseSVN,如果不習慣英文界面的話還有中文語言包可以安裝,真是十分方便。

對于局域網內有服務器支持的版本管理系統,按照軟件的幫助手冊中的說明去建立就好。本文主要講述如果SVN建立本地文件版本管理,也就是服務器和客戶端都在一臺機器上的情況。

按照TortoiseSVN的幫助文檔中的說明,在新建的空文件夾上使用右鍵菜單的createrepositoryhere命令成功建立一個倉庫后,使用右鍵的import命令來向倉庫中裝載尚未版本化的源碼的話,就會報出如下錯誤:

Unabletoopenanra_localsessiontoURL

Unabletoopenrepository'file:///D:/explorer'

注意上面的路徑是正確的,但是用這種方法就是怎么也不能把源碼放入版本庫里,我在網絡上搜索了好久也沒有找到解決方法,所以我相信這應該是TortoiseSVN的一個bug吧!

因為兩年前上學的時候曾經使用過一段TortoiseSVN,因此在不斷回憶和嘗試的探索下,我終于找到了一種可以將源碼正確放入倉庫進行版本化管理的方法。具體操作如下:

1.先建立一個倉庫,沒導入源碼前這個倉庫是空的。

2.在源碼的文件夾上右鍵選擇checkout命令,這是導出倉庫中的代碼的操作。在彈出的對話框中選擇剛才建立好的空倉庫后,會得到相應的的情況:

其中我新建的倉庫名是mydisk,我的源碼所在的文件夾是newproject。注意,這時SVN自動要在newproject目錄下新建了一個名為mydisk的文件夾來存放導出的內容,這不是我們希望的,如果這樣的話那么newproject中的源碼就無法導入到mydisk倉庫內了,所以刪除checkoutdirectory項下路徑中的mydisk,然后單擊確定,軟件會提示當前的文件夾是非空的,詢問是否繼續,選擇是即可。會打印出如下信息:Atrevision:0。表示版本庫已經順利導入了當前源碼所在的文件夾,雖然這個版本庫是空的。

3.再次在源碼的文件夾上單擊右鍵,就可以看到菜單的命令項多出了許多,同時也有SVNupdate和SVNcommit命令了,這是因為SVN版本庫已經位于當前源碼所在的文件夾了。選擇add命令,在彈出的對話框中選擇所有源碼文件、取消那些工程控制文件,單擊確定,就可以看到SVN會打印出把所有的源碼添加到版本庫的過程了。但是,這是源碼還沒有真正加入到版本庫內。

4.再次在源碼的文件夾上單擊右鍵,選擇SVNcommit命令,在彈出的對話框中可以看到前面選擇的源碼文件都在即將加入到版本庫的候選列表中,在這里也可以選擇或者取消是否將某個文件加入到版本庫中,添加好日志信息后,單擊確定,就可以看到SVN真正地將數據導入到倉庫的過程了。

5.此時可以繼續在原來的源碼文件夾內開發修改并提交到版本庫進行控制,也可以新建一個文件夾從版本庫導出一個版本,然后在此基礎上開發。本節關于正確使用SVN建立本地文件管理方法介紹完畢。

【編輯推薦】

  1. 常見SVN用法詳解
  2. 技術分享 SVNServe如何建立SVN服務
  3. SVN建庫方法全程揭秘
  4. Windows下啟動SVN服務應注意的七大問題
  5. 學習筆記: 如何刪除SVN版本控制信息

 

責任編輯:佚名 來源: csdn.net
相關推薦

2010-09-25 09:24:54

Java內存管理

2010-06-01 19:55:30

SVN使用

2012-12-24 09:14:31

ios

2010-07-07 09:02:30

SQL Server內

2010-05-31 11:30:57

SVN使用

2010-05-25 17:35:12

SVN代理

2014-11-10 09:51:18

數據中心ITIL

2023-07-25 15:06:39

2015-06-04 10:19:33

數據中心

2023-11-02 00:18:47

風險管理系統驅動

2010-05-27 09:56:54

SVN文件沖突

2010-05-27 09:17:44

Linux網絡流量

2011-03-03 10:32:28

ProftpdMysql管理

2009-10-21 14:48:39

Oracle用戶權限表

2023-08-31 00:02:28

2010-05-31 09:47:40

2013-08-23 15:23:13

輕應用百度

2010-05-26 14:28:53

本地SVN

2010-05-27 11:12:10

SVN目錄結構

2009-12-08 17:26:47

博科資訊零基預算管理
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 精品视频www| 免费国产一区 | 一区二区三区亚洲 | 麻豆精品国产91久久久久久 | 中文字幕第7页 | 国产精品视频999 | 美女激情av | 蜜桃视频在线观看免费视频网站www | 激情欧美一区二区三区 | 日日欧美| 亚洲精品国产区 | 超碰综合 | 国产激情视频 | 色久五月| 欧美黑人国产人伦爽爽爽 | www.久久久久久久久久久久 | 国产精品一区一区三区 | 亚洲视频免费在线播放 | 久久国产精品一区二区三区 | 成人免费区一区二区三区 | 久久黄网 | 中文字幕在线精品 | 国产9999精品 | 黄色免费在线网址 | 在线欧美小视频 | 欧美一区二区三区四区五区无卡码 | 精品久久久久一区 | 亚洲超碰在线观看 | 国产福利资源在线 | 一级片av | a视频在线观看 | 国产精品永久免费视频 | 国产视频一区在线 | 中文精品一区二区 | 精产嫩模国品一二三区 | 亚洲精品v日韩精品 | aaa国产大片| 日韩视频三区 | 中文在线一区二区 | 国产精品久久久久久久久久久久 | 亚洲高清视频在线观看 |